Summary

Florida High defensive back Antonio Dickey Jr. is actively seeking his first college football scholarship offer while preparing for his senior season. He has participated in several camps, including events at Florida A&M and Florida State, striving to improve his skills and raise his profile among college coaches. Dickey, who recorded 81 tackles during his junior year, aims to make the All-Big Bend First Team and increase his academic standing to help secure offers. Despite key player losses, Florida High enters the new season focused on a strong performance after a playoff appearance last year.
